
The premier national conference building the capacity of African American faith organizations to become community hubs for health awareness, education, and support.
Our four-day public health conference reflects the Black church worship traditions of preaching, teaching, praying, and singing.
Our goal is to equip churches and congregational health ministries to become community hubs for health awareness, treatment, and support to help reverse and eliminate the impact of health disparities in Black communities.
